I choose this book, just because of the title " God is my CEO -Following God’s Principles in a Bottom-Line World"


Author : Larry Julian


Publication: Adams Media


Most of the western self-help, motivational and inspiring books have stories and illustrations from Bible. The bible has two major books, Old Testament and New Testament. The old testaments is more about - HOPE and New Testament is on FAITH & Belief. The books touches the management concept of career development using the faith and integrity.


Introduction : - Let Your Faith Define Who You Are


when you integrate God into your work world, pressures that were once stressful


will empower you.


*Principle 1:** Determining Your Purpose


*Principle 2:** Success Means Doing Something that Matters


*Principle 3:** It Takes Courage to Do What’s Right


*Principle 4:** Patience Provides a Long-Range Perspective


*Principle 5:** Lead by Your Actions


*Principle 6:** When Things Are Out of Control, Trust God


*Principle 7**: Between the Lesser of Two Evils, Choose Good


*Principle 8:** Servant Leaders Serve Their Employees


*Principle 9:** To Balance Employees and Profi ts, Put People First


*Principle 10:** Avoid Burnout by Putting First Things First


Under each of the principles, the author has written two inspirational stories about how God has inspired them to do differently and follow his words. There are good quotes taken from the bible.


*Bottom-Line*


I loved the following paragraph which captures the essence of the book:


Patience and bottom-line pressure are like oil and water. They don't mix. Having the patience to work a long term plan sounds great in theory, but, in reality, short term pressure often forces us to pay another game. Pressure comes from both external and internal forces. The bottom-line exception to produce, coupled with our internal pressure to succeed, takes us out of our game plan. We exhaust our energies sprinting from quarter to quarter, running a race dictated by pressure. With patience, we learn to run the race we have been called to run, in-spite of the pressure that surrounds us.
